What is Folic Acid Folic acid is a water-soluble vitamin that does not exist in nature and has no biological activity, but is a precursor of biologically active folate. Folate is widely present in nature, found in both animals and plants, and is abundant in liver, kidney, green leafy vegetables, potatoes, wheat bran, etc. Folic acid can transfer a carbon group (methyl or formyl) to deoxyuridine, converting it into deoxythymidylic acid and then synthesizing DNA. What does the folic acid test check? 1. Determination of red blood cell, white blood cell, platelet count as well as hemoglobin and hematocrit is collectively referred to as peripheral blood measurement. When folic acid is deficient, the anemia is macrocytic (MCV>100 fl); when folic acid is severely deficient, the enlarged neutrophil population is accompanied by a right shift of the nucleus. 2. Measure the bone marrow. When folic acid is deficient, vacuoles will form in the cytoplasm and megakaryocytes will have excessive nuclear lobation. 3. Serum folate is measured by microbial or radiocompetitive protein binding techniques. 4. Determine red blood cell folate, and simultaneously determine red blood cell, whole blood folate, and serum folate hematocrit. 5. Determination of urinary iminoformylglutamate. Under normal circumstances, the reference standard value for human excretion is <3 mg/24h; in the case of folic acid deficiency, the human excretion may rise to 1000 mg/24h or even higher. 6. Measure folic acid in paper blood smear specimens. This method requires less blood and is simpler to operate. Is folic acid test necessary?
